2. External Property Assessment
- Our expert will begin by inspecting the exterior of the building.
- We look for issues such as blocked gutters, defective brickwork, cracked rendering, or poor drainage — all of which can lead to penetrating damp.
- We also check DPC (Damp Proof Course) lines and ground levels where rising damp could be occurring.
3. Internal Survey and Moisture Readings
- Inside the property, we use professional equipment to check moisture levels in walls, floors, and ceilings.
- We inspect for:
- Visible damp patches and water staining
- Peeling paint or wallpaper
- Signs of black mould or condensation
- Soft, crumbling plaster or rotten skirting boards
- Our surveyor may use a digital moisture meter or thermal imaging camera to detect hidden damp or heat loss issues.
4. Identify the Type and Cause of Damp
We categorise the issue into one of the following types:
- Condensation: Common in homes with poor ventilation, especially bathrooms and kitchens.
- Rising Damp: Caused by ground moisture rising through walls due to a failed or missing DPC.
- Penetrating Damp: Caused by water entering from external faults such as leaking pipes, cracked walls, or roofing issues.
